Examining Common HVAC Line Set Issues
When your climate control system isn't performing as expected, analyzing the line set is a crucial first step. These refrigerant lines can develop issues that hamper efficiency and performance.
Common culprits include frozen coils, leaks, and damaged connections. A trained HVAC technician can detect these problems and provide the necessary fixes.
Here are some typical line set issues to be aware of:
* Punctures: These can occur at multiple points the line set, causing refrigerant loss and reducing system efficiency.
* Blocked Coils: This condition happens when airflow is impeded, leading to a buildup of frost on the coils. It disrupts heat transfer and reduces system performance.
* Damage: Over time, line sets can become corroded due to exposure to the elements or chemicals. This can lead to structural failure and potential leaks.
Scheduled maintenance by a qualified HVAC technician can help minimize these issues and keep your cooling system running smoothly.
Perks of Using a Pre-Charged Line Set
Installing a pre-charged line set can be a real time saver for HVAC technicians. These line sets are already pressurized with refrigerant, eliminating the need to pump out air and then charge the system after installation. This means you can spend less time on setup and more time executing other tasks.
Another advantage is that pre-charged line sets minimize the risk of refrigerant leaks during setup. With proper handling, these line sets are built to be leak-proof, ensuring a more efficient cooling or heating system.
